American soccer player and Olympic gold medalist ranked the third in most beautiful women in sports. She was born on July 2, 1989, in Diamond Bar, California.
She is a striker for National Women’s Soccer League club Portland Thorns FC and the U.S. Women’s National Team. She was drafted number one overall in the 2011 WPS Draft by the Western New York Flash where she made her professional debut. She was subsequently named U.S. Soccer Female Athlete of the Year and was a FIFA World Player of the year finalist.

Born on December 3, 1987, in Boston, Massachusetts, Alicia Sacramone is a retired American artistic gymnast. She began studying dance at the age of five and started training gymnastics three years later, at age eight, in 1996.
She started competing in the elite ranks in 2002 and joined the U.S. national team in 2003. From 2004 to 2010, she won total of 10 gold medals overall, joining Shannon Miller and Nastia Liukin as the U.S. athletes with the most medals at the gymnastics. Also, she is the second-most decorated American gymnast in World Championship history.
